Can I get a job with just an associate's degree in computer engineering?
Yes. Entry-level computer engineering technician and support roles are available to associate's degree holders. Median starting salary is $45,500 (BLS, 2024). However, advancement to senior roles requires a bachelor's degree or significant experience.

How long does it take to complete an associate's degree?
Full-time students complete in 2 years (4 semesters). Part-time students may take 3-4 years. Accelerated programs can finish in 18 months with year-round enrollment.
Is an associate's degree better than a bootcamp?
It depends on your goals. Associate's degrees offer broader education, transfer pathways, and wider employer recognition. Bootcamps are faster but limited to specific roles. Associate's is better for long-term career flexibility.

Ranking Factors

Program Completions35%

Number of graduates per year in this specific field (CIP code). Larger programs indicate established departments with more resources, course offerings, and career services. Measured from IPEDS Completions data.

Graduation Rate25%

Percentage of students completing their degree within 150% of expected time (6 years for bachelor's, 3 years for associate's). Higher rates indicate better student support and program quality. Source: IPEDS Graduation Rates survey.

Selectivity20%

Admission rate (lower = more selective). More selective institutions have stronger academic environments and more competitive graduates. For open-admission institutions, we use graduation rates as a proxy for quality.

Career Outcomes20%

National salary data for computer engineering graduates, factored into institutional scores based on job market strength.
